  • What is the typical weather in Philadelphie, PA, and how does it affect outdoor plans?

    Philadelphia has four distinct seasons. Summers are hot and humid, reaching around 29 degrees Celsius, while winters are cold and snowy, with temperatures around 0 degrees Celsius. Spring and autumn are mild and pleasant, ideal for outdoor activities.

  • What are the best parks near Philadelphia?

    Philadelphia has plenty of green spaces that can provide you with peace and tranquillity. However, it also has some great parks where you can walk when you want to breathe in some fresh air. Bisected by the Schuylkill River, Fairmount Park is a combination of 63 parks, gardens, hiking trails and historic mansions. If you are looking for a fun time you can head to Clark Park where you can enjoy soccer and basketball games. With a big splash fountain, Sister Cities Park can offer you a great experience for some quiet time. Franklin Square and Rittenhouse Square are also popular green spaces that you can explore in the city.

  • How can I get around Philadelphia?

    Philadelphia is often voted as one of the best walking cities in the United States. If you are in the Center City you can explore most of the area on foot. The easy-to-follow grid street design makes it easier for you to find local attractions, popular restaurants and cafes and shops. However, if you are not into walking you can take a bicycle as Philly has 440 miles of dedicated bike lanes. You can use a city-wide bike-sharing service like Indego. Philadelphia also has an excellent public transit system that would allow you to cover more spaces across the city in a short time.

  • What are the most popular street foods in Philadelphia?

    When you are exploring Philadelphia, you would certainly want to get your hands on popular street foods that you can find. Philly cheesesteaks are probably the most iconic and popular food you can find which you can eat on the go. However, while you are exploring different food trucks you can also find roast pork sandwiches which is a Philly signature dish. If you are looking for subs, Philly Hoagie is a great option to try out available in a variety of bread. Pretzels are also quite popular on Philadelphia streets along with scrapple which is a blend of pork, cornmeal and spices.
  • Which hiking trails are recommended for exploring in and around Philadelphie, PA?

    For hiking, try the Wissahickon Valley Park, just a short drive from the city. It offers miles of trails winding through forests and along the Wissahickon Creek. Another option is the Schuylkill River Trail, a paved path that stretches along the river, offering scenic views of the city.
